Orchard Hill College is an Outstanding Specialist College (Ofsted, November 2019) offering life-changing learning opportunities to young people and adults with a range of special education needs and/or disabilities. We have eight vibrant community-based College Centres across London and Surrey where committed, specialist teams deliver a range of programmes to meet the needs of over 400 students.
Students who study with us have a wide range of needs including profound and multiple learning disabilities, communication and behavioural difficulties and specific medical needs. All students are individual and their learning programme is designed to support and empower them to achieve their aspirations and goals, whilst developing skills to become more independent members of their community. As the Deputy Head of College, you will work alongside the Head of College and another Deputy Head to lead the academic and pastoral development of our students.
Responsibilities:
• Support the strategic leadership of the College, helping to set high standards for teaching, learning, and student well-being,
• Deputise for the Head of College and take responsibility for the day-to-day operational management of the College when required,
• Lead on initiatives to promote student progress, engagement, and wellbeing, ensuring every learner reaches their full potential.
• Maintain and enhance positive relationships with parents, carers, and external partner.
Requirements:
• Proven leadership experience in an educational setting, ideally within special education.
• Commitment to inclusive education and improving outcomes for students with diverse needs.
• Relevant teaching qualification and leadership qualifications.
